summaryrefslogtreecommitdiff
path: root/sysutils/asapm
diff options
context:
space:
mode:
authorjlam <jlam@pkgsrc.org>1999-07-12 00:04:57 +0000
committerjlam <jlam@pkgsrc.org>1999-07-12 00:04:57 +0000
commit8d9501c5bfd41aa31912dcaefb209839799be9bc (patch)
tree8b7f47e46a1ce6db7d52df9ea02f60a52b6dfe3e /sysutils/asapm
parentd3f8b4af50302a612bfb9877275018895f325508 (diff)
downloadpkgsrc-8d9501c5bfd41aa31912dcaefb209839799be9bc.tar.gz
* Disable check for (unused) JPEG libraries.
* Make ELF-aware.
Diffstat (limited to 'sysutils/asapm')
-rw-r--r--sysutils/asapm/Makefile5
-rw-r--r--sysutils/asapm/patches/patch-ab13
-rw-r--r--sysutils/asapm/patches/patch-ac12
3 files changed, 28 insertions, 2 deletions
diff --git a/sysutils/asapm/Makefile b/sysutils/asapm/Makefile
index da61ab142e2..46355ddb2b8 100644
--- a/sysutils/asapm/Makefile
+++ b/sysutils/asapm/Makefile
@@ -1,4 +1,4 @@
-# $NetBSD: Makefile,v 1.4 1999/05/24 20:39:48 tv Exp $
+# $NetBSD: Makefile,v 1.5 1999/07/12 00:04:57 jlam Exp $
# FreeBSD Id: Makefile,v 1.5 1998/11/29 12:43:12 asami Exp
#
@@ -8,7 +8,7 @@ MASTER_SITES= http://www.tigr.net/afterstep/as-apps/download/asapm/ \
ftp://ftp.afterstep.org/apps/asapm/ \
ftp://fuf.sh.cvut.cz/pub/AfterStep/apps/asapm/
-MAINTAINER= lamj@stat.cmu.edu
+MAINTAINER= jlam@netbsd.org
HOMEPAGE= http://www.tigr.net/afterstep/as-apps/applet-list.html
DEPENDS= xpm-3.4k:../../graphics/xpm
@@ -17,5 +17,6 @@ ONLY_FOR_PLATFORM= *-*-i386 # needs apm support
GNU_CONFIGURE= yes
USE_X11BASE= yes
+CONFIGURE_ARGS+= --disable-jpeg # there actually is no JPEG support
.include "../../mk/bsd.pkg.mk"
diff --git a/sysutils/asapm/patches/patch-ab b/sysutils/asapm/patches/patch-ab
new file mode 100644
index 00000000000..737b229c758
--- /dev/null
+++ b/sysutils/asapm/patches/patch-ab
@@ -0,0 +1,13 @@
+$NetBSD: patch-ab,v 1.1 1999/07/12 00:04:58 jlam Exp $
+
+--- autoconf/Makefile.common.in.orig Sun Jul 11 04:53:01 1999
++++ autoconf/Makefile.common.in Sun Jul 11 04:57:53 1999
+@@ -34,7 +34,7 @@
+ done
+
+ $(PROG): $(OBJS)
+- $(CC) $(OBJS) $(LIBRARIES) $(EXTRA_LIBRARIES) -o $(@)
++ $(CC) -o $(@) $(OBJS) $(LDFLAGS) $(LIBRARIES) $(EXTRA_LIBRARIES)
+
+ .c.o:
+ $(CC) $(CCFLAGS) $(EXTRA_DEFINES) $(INCLUDES) $(EXTRA_INCLUDES) -c $*.c
diff --git a/sysutils/asapm/patches/patch-ac b/sysutils/asapm/patches/patch-ac
new file mode 100644
index 00000000000..167483215d8
--- /dev/null
+++ b/sysutils/asapm/patches/patch-ac
@@ -0,0 +1,12 @@
+$NetBSD: patch-ac,v 1.1 1999/07/12 00:04:58 jlam Exp $
+
+--- autoconf/Makefile.defines.in.orig Tue Feb 23 04:56:05 1999
++++ autoconf/Makefile.defines.in Sun Jul 11 04:58:26 1999
+@@ -28,6 +28,7 @@
+ INCS_XPM = @XPM_CFLAGS@
+ INCLUDES = $(INCS_X) $(INCS_XPM)
+
++LDFLAGS = @LDFLAGS@
+ LIBS_X = @X_LIBS@ @x_libs@
+ LIBS_XPM =
+ LIBS_JPEG = @JPEG_LIB@